Output 1666813c664f4e0db73cb160aa65216fa8e20f728a2536a28eb3c0829c23ec2b:1

value
182396
script pubkey
OP_0 OP_PUSHBYTES_20 8ec3b81ee446d6f88f24b45c011d883583e5ce59
address
bc1q3mpms8hygmt03reyk3wqz8vgxkp7tnjea8vk2l
transaction
1666813c664f4e0db73cb160aa65216fa8e20f728a2536a28eb3c0829c23ec2b
spent
true